Is there a way to implement web page code that when surfing to it, it can mute all desktop applications running on the client machine? Or there are permissions level that won’t allow doing that? Maybe it requires for me to implement some browser plugin (or existing one) to get that access?

    Or there are permissions level that won’t allow doing that?

    No, it is not possible for a web site to turn down the system volume or influence it in any other way – and thank goodness for that. It used to be possible to have full-screen web sites (if that’s what you mean by “mute”), but that has gone due to problems with fraud.
